ページの先頭行へ戻る
Interstage Mobile Application Server V1.2.0 アプリケーション開発ガイド
FUJITSU Software

B.10.2 レスポンス

ステータスコード
表 B.1 APIが返却するステータスコードを参照してください。
ヘッダー
Content-Type: application/json; charset=UTF-8
ボディ
以下の形式です。
{
    "response": {
        "code": "ステータスコード",
        "message": "メッセージ"
    },
    "regIDs":
     [
        {
          "regID": "登録ID",
          "count": "蓄積数",
          "messages": [
                {"message":送信メッセージ(JSON形式),"timestamp":"送信日時"}
                {"message":送信メッセージ(JSON形式),"timestamp":"送信日時"}
          ]
        },
        {
          "regID": "登録ID",
          "count": "蓄積数",
          "messages": [
                {"message":送信メッセージ(JSON形式),"timestamp":"送信日時"}
                {"message":送信メッセージ(JSON形式),"timestamp":"送信日時"}
          ]
        },
        ...
    ]
}

変数名

説明

response

レスポンス

code

ステータスコード

int

message

メッセージ

String

regIDs

登録IDのリスト

配列

regID

登録ID

String

count

蓄積数

int

messages

メッセージ内容のリスト

配列

message

メッセージ内容

String

timestamp

送信日時

timestamp



注意事項
  • 蓄積メッセージの一覧取得(regIDを指定しない場合)は、未接続のIMAPSプッシュIDの情報が取得できます。プッシュ基盤サーバに接続しているIMAPSプッシュIDの情報は取得できません。
  • メッセージが蓄積していない登録IDもレスポンス対象であり、蓄積数が0("count":0)として返ります。